Output 7b86da3d663008daa64b782cf018b90f6677d1df207e2ece9df50be4e7b9e8c7: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01e4886c4dbc07c6b73dcc8566dcc416999330a6 OP_EQUAL
address
31s2NUo52aFDJybtJk8CiJie2vzqpD4gJC
transaction
7b86da3d663008daa64b782cf018b90f6677d1df207e2ece9df50be4e7b9e8c7
spent
true